The function InvokeInputMethodFunction() is responsible for invocation of IME API. Typically it uses PostMessage() to execute corresponding IME function on the toolkit thread but if DnD operation takes place SendMessage() is used. The state of m_inputMethodWaitEvent event object remains signalled after SendMessage() execution. That causes failure of subsequent IME functions calls via PostMessage().
Fix:
SendMessage() and PostMessage() calls inside InvokeInputMethodFunction() should be synchronised. The state of m_inputMethodWaitEvent event object must be reseted right after SendMessage() execution.
